One of the films that had a substantial amount of buzz heading into the festival was Netflixâs release of Dee Reesâ film, The Last Thing He Wanted. The film had been scheduled for release in 2019, but had been held by Netflix and subsequently added to the 2020 Sundance Film Festival lineup. Expectations for the film were high following Dee Reesâ incredible success with her last Sundance foray, Mudbound. The film sold to Netflix for 12.5 million dollars and went on to earn 4 Academy Award nominations in 2017. Needless to say, Reesâ follow-up film was expected to do big things, especially considering The Last Thing He Wanted boasted a stellar cast that included Anne Hathaway, Willem Dafoe, and Rosie Perez. However, upon premiering at the 2020 Sundance Film Festival, The Last Thing He Wanted was met with vicious reviews from critics and mediocre notices from its confused and disappointed Sundance audience. The film currently sits at 9% fresh rating on Rotten Tomatoes.
